Send ranges from excel to outlook

CepheiMD

New Member
Joined
Apr 1, 2016
Messages
10
Please help with the following.

I have an excel file with employees information and I need to send it to all the employees (each employee should receive his information).

There a more than 500 employees so send to each person with copy-paste its unreal.

For example, first email will be sent with range A1:C3 to the person from A2 (by viewing the mini sheet attached you can understand better my task)

salary ex.xlsx
ABCDEFGHIJKL
1InfoExample (message 1)
2John Johnson, ID 100to:John.Johnson@yahoo.com
3Salary 5 USDSubjectSalary info for last year
4BodyHello, please see your salary info from last year
5Info
6Mr. Bob Moore, id 200Info
7Salary3 USDMr. John Johnson
8Salary 5 USD
9Info
10Mr. Jack Grealish, id
11Salary4 USDExample (message 2)
12to:Bob.Moore@yahoo.com
13***SubjectSalary info for last year
14BodyHello, please see your salary info from last year
15
16Info
17Mr. Bob Moore, id 200
18Salary3 USD
19
20
21***
22
23General
24SubjectSalary info for last year
25BodyHello, please see your salary info from last year
26
Sheet1
 

Excel Facts

Can Excel fill bagel flavors?
You can teach Excel a new custom list. Type the list in cells, File, Options, Advanced, Edit Custom Lists, Import, OK
Still not in table format...

Hello again.

I formated the table with employees data as table.
My boss asked to review each message before submit it, so if its possible to make not to send it but just to create new message with all data completed. In this case, for so much amount of data I'm afraid that Outlook will crash. As a solution I see to create by 100 message (I understand that I'll have to adjust the range in the VBA code).

P.S. Sorry if not provided data in correct format again

model info.xls
BCDEFGHIJKLMNOPQRSTUVWXYZAAABACADAEAFAGAH
1Outlook TemplateComments:
2to:john.johnson@yahoo.comemail from the table
3SubjectInfo 2021static text
4Body:Hello, please see below the information about salary for 2021static text
5
6
7Anexa nr.5 la
8Ordinul Ministerului Finanțelor nr. 135 din 06 noiembrie 2017
9NameIDSalaryemailMonths worked
10Приложение № 5John Johnson12525 USDjohn.johnson@yahoo.com5
11к Приказу Министерствa финансов № 135 от 06 ноября 2017 г.Fred Andrew13553 USDfred.andrew@yahoo.com3
12Jack Wilfred12204 USDjack.wilfred@yahoo.com8
13
14INFORMAŢIE
15nr.1 din 31.12.2021 cell I15 = counter from 1 to …
16privind salariul şi alte plăţi efectuate de către rezidentul parcului pentru tehnologia informaţiei in folosul angajatului
17ИНФОРМАЦИЯ
181 от 31.12.2021I18 =I15
19о заработной плате и о других выплатах, осуществленных резидентом информационно - теxнологического парка в пользу работника
20
21ÎCS "" SRL, cod fiscal
22Prin prezenta / Настоящим,
23(denumirea rezidentului parcului IT, codul fiscal)
24(наименование резидента информационно - технологического парка, фискальный код)
25
26confirmă că, / подтверждает что,John Johnson, 1252E26 = Name + Id from the table
27(numele, prenumele şi codul fiscal al angajatului în folosul căruia au fost efectuate platile)
28(фамилия,имя и фискальный код работника, в пользу которого были произведены выплаты)
29
30pe parcursul anului 2 021 a beneficiat de urmatorul venit pentru activitatea desfasurata in parcul pentru tehnologia informatiei: / в течение года получил следующий доход за осуществленную деятельность в информационно - технологическогом парке:
31
32Suma venitului sub forma de salariu, plati de stimulare si compensare (lei)Nr. de luni in care angajatul a activat in parcul pentru tehnologia informatiei
33Сумма дохода, в виде заработной платы, поощрительных выплат и компенсации (в леях)№ месяцев, в котором работник работал информационно - технологическогом парке
3412
355 USD5D35 = Salary from table
36Q35 = Months worked from table
37Notă/Примечания:
38La persoana care este obligata sa prezinte informatia respectiva este necesar sa ramina confirmarea precum ca aceasta a remis sau a inminat informatia persoanei in folosul careia au fost efectuate platile.
39
40У лица, обязанного предоставить информацию, должно остаться подтверждение о том, что данная информация отправлена или вручена лицу, в пользу которoго произведена выплата.
41
42
43
44Conducatorul Contabil-sef
45Руководитель(semnatura \ подпись)Главный бухгалтер(semnatura \ подпись)
46
47
48
49
50[Outlook default signature]
51
52
53
54
55
56
TDSheet
 
Upvote 0

Forum statistics

Threads
1,223,264
Messages
6,171,085
Members
452,378
Latest member
Hoodzy01

We've detected that you are using an adblocker.

We have a great community of people providing Excel help here, but the hosting costs are enormous. You can help keep this site running by allowing ads on MrExcel.com.
Allow Ads at MrExcel

Which adblocker are you using?

Disable AdBlock

Follow these easy steps to disable AdBlock

1)Click on the icon in the browser’s toolbar.
2)Click on the icon in the browser’s toolbar.
2)Click on the "Pause on this site" option.
Go back

Disable AdBlock Plus

Follow these easy steps to disable AdBlock Plus

1)Click on the icon in the browser’s toolbar.
2)Click on the toggle to disable it for "mrexcel.com".
Go back

Disable uBlock Origin

Follow these easy steps to disable uBlock Origin

1)Click on the icon in the browser’s toolbar.
2)Click on the "Power" button.
3)Click on the "Refresh" button.
Go back

Disable uBlock

Follow these easy steps to disable uBlock

1)Click on the icon in the browser’s toolbar.
2)Click on the "Power" button.
3)Click on the "Refresh" button.
Go back
Back
Top